The highly anticipated Premier League football weekend gets under way on August 14, 2025, with live commentary and expert analysis available on BBC Radio 5 Live and the BBC Sounds app. Fans across the UK can tune in at 19:30 UK time to hear the latest insights on the action, hosted by Kelly Somers, with former professional striker Glenn Murray providing expert punditry. BBC Radio 5 Live is one of the premier destinations for comprehensive live football broadcasts in the UK. Renowned for its authoritative sports coverage, the station combines knowledgeable presenting with top-tier commentary, making it a favourite among football enthusiasts who prefer radio coverage. Kelly Somers, the presenter for this broadcast, is a respected sports journalist known for her sharp interviewing skills and thorough knowledge of football. She has developed a strong reputation presenting Premier League matches on the BBC, bringing clarity and enthusiasm to the pre-match and post-match analyses. Joining Somers is Glenn Murray, a celebrated former Premier League striker who played for clubs such as Reading, Crystal Palace, and Brighton & Hove Albion. His firsthand experience in England’s top flight lends valuable perspective to the analysis, particularly regarding attacking play and forward positioning. Murray’s transition to punditry has been well received, with listeners appreciating his clear, insightful commentary and tactical understanding. While the earliest fixtures of the 2025/26 Premier League season officially start on August 15 with Liverpool hosting AFC Bournemouth at 20:00 UK time on Sky Sports, the August 14 evening programming on BBC 5 Live sets the tone for the weekend. The season promises to be an exciting one, featuring promoted sides like Leeds United, Burnley, and Sunderland rejoining the top flight and fresh storylines including the first full season with semi-automated offside technology in use. BBC Radio 5 Live’s role as the live audio partner complements the extensive televised coverage provided by Sky Sports and TNT Sports, which will broadcast many matches throughout the season. For reference, the Premier League continues through to May 24, 2026, with a robust fixture list of 380 matches, showcasing the very best of English football.
